- No prefix provided ?The SAP error message CNV20305717, which states "No prefix provided," typically occurs in the context of data migration or conversion processes, particularly when using the SAP S/4HANA Migration Cockpit or similar tools. This error indicates that a required prefix for a certain operation or data object has not been specified.
Cause:
- Missing Configuration: The error often arises when a necessary configuration setting, such as a prefix for a data object or table, has not been defined in the migration settings.
- Incorrect Mapping: If the mapping of source and target fields is not correctly set up, it may lead to this error.
- Data Model Issues: The data model being used for the migration may not have the required prefixes defined for certain fields or objects.
Solution:
- Check Migration Settings: Review the migration settings in the SAP Migration Cockpit or the relevant tool you are using. Ensure that all required prefixes are defined.
- Define Prefixes: If you are using custom objects or fields, make sure to define the necessary prefixes in the configuration.
- Review Mapping: Go through the mapping of source and target fields to ensure that all required fields are correctly mapped and that prefixes are included where necessary.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to the official SAP documentation for the specific migration tool you are using to understand the requirements for prefixes and how to configure them properly.
- Error Logs: Check the error logs for more detailed information about where the error is occurring, which can provide clues on how to resolve it.
